Still affects aptitude 0.4.11.11 on Ubuntu 10.04 as of 24 Mar 2010. It just merrily munched my custom-rebuilt netatalk package, knocking all the Mac OS 9 systems required for critical legacy apps off the network. Ouch!
$ cat /etc/apt/preferences.d/netatalk Package: netatalk Pin: origin "" Pin-Priority: 1001 $ sudo apt-get upgrade Reading package lists... Done Building dependency tree Reading state information... Done The following packages have been kept back: netatalk 0 upgraded, 0 newly installed, 0 to remove and 1 not upgraded. $ sudo aptitude safe-upgrade Reading package lists... Done Building dependency tree Reading state information... Done Reading extended state information Initializing package states... Done Writing extended state information... Done The following packages will be upgraded: netatalk The following packages are RECOMMENDED but will NOT be installed: libpam-cracklib rc 1 packages upgraded, 0 newly installed, 0 to remove and 0 not upgraded. Need to get 0B/831kB of archives. After unpacking 81.9kB will be freed. Do you want to continue?
